Re: Last Elvis Album (LP) You Listened To Was?
I've been listening today to Elvis in Demand. The version I have is the 1982 reissue with the blue label. I used to have the original yellow label release, and I don't remember it ever sounding like this. This blue label version is one of the best sounding (vintage) Elvis LPs I've heard. I'm not quite sure why that is, or why it should sound better than the original release (providing it does - I haven't heard the yellow since I sold it back in 2005).
